Bees and other pollinators are extremely attracted to clover flowers, and clover is an integral part of … WebFeb 24, 2015 · Dwarf Clover . NPS photo by D. Pinigis. Dwarf Clover. Scientific name: Trifolium nanum . Family: Pea family (Fabaceae) ... This small cushion plant resembles moss and is made up of tightly packed leaves dotted with pale pink to bright rose-colored flowers. It grows to a height of only 2"-3" ( 5-7cm), and may have a taproot 4' – 5' (120 …

WebClover Specifications. Miniclover® (Trifolium repens) is a perennial, drought tolerant white clover only growing to approximately 4 - 6 inches tall making it ideal for a lawn alternative or to mix with your current lawn grass. …

WebUsing dish soap. If you have a small patch of moss, you can mix 1 gallon of water and 2 ounces of dish soap into a spray bottle and spray the mix onto patches of moss. For larger lawns you should double the proportions of each.
